The order of events that is most accurate for activation of G protein coupled receptors signaling pathways is: Hormone binds GPCR, GPCR binds with G protein, G protein loses GDP and gains GTP, G-protein alpha subunit activates intracellular proteins.
Why is this correct?
This series of events stands as the most precise and widely acknowledged process for initiating G-protein-coupled receptor (GPCR) signaling pathways according to contemporary scientific comprehension.
It is extensively documented and serves as the standard pathway for GPCR signaling, holding significant importance in diverse cellular functions and physiological responses.
